The reactions of oxide compounds to produce carbonates, phosphates, and sulfates are described in the section on oxides in Group 16 of the Elements Handbook. Use those equations (given below) to answer the following questions. MgO(s) + CO2(g) MgCO3(s) 6 CaO(s) + P4O10(s) 2 Ca3(PO4)2(s) CaO(s) + SO3(g) CaSO4(s) (a) What mass of CO2 is needed to react with 162.6 g MgO? g (b) What mass of magnesium carbonate is produced? g (c) When 45.7 g P4O10 is reacted with an excess of calcium oxide, what mass of calcium phosphate is produced? g
